AFC Launches New Media Accreditation System for Events and Competitions

The Asian Football Confederation (AFC) has introduced a new online Media Channel for journalists and other media representatives seeking accreditation for its events and competitions.

The AFC said the former Media Channel will no longer be operational, with information and applications relating to media accreditation for AFC events and competitions now handled through the new platform.

Media representatives must register on the new system before they can access AFC events and competitions that are open for accreditation. The move means journalists intending to cover AFC competitions should ensure their registration is completed before attempting to submit an accreditation application.

The confederation has also made a user guide available through its media extranet to assist applicants with the registration process. Journalists who experience technical or registration difficulties have been advised to contact the AFC Media & Broadcast Operations Team.

For sports journalists across Asia, including Afghan media professionals covering continental football and futsal competitions, the change is important because future AFC accreditation opportunities will be administered through the new system.
